In a typical middle-class home in Delhi or Kolkata, the first sound isn't an alarm clock—it's the whistle of a pressure cooker or the clinking of spoons against saucers. The chai (tea) is non-negotiable. However, the culture story here isn't about the tea itself; it is about the tapri (street tea stall). Millions of Indians begin their day not at home, but standing by a roadside stall, sipping sweet, spicy chai from a small clay kulhad . The Indian lifestyle is perhaps best understood through the lens of its domestic life. Historically, the joint family system served as the primary social safety net, where multiple generations lived under one roof. While urbanization has led to a rise in nuclear families, the emotional and economic ties to the extended family remain a cornerstone of identity. Sundays are often dedicated to elaborate family meals, and major life events like weddings are not merely private unions but massive communal celebrations that can last for days, involving hundreds of guests and intricate rituals that vary by region and religion.

However, the modern Indian story is also one of transition. In cities like Bengaluru, Mumbai, and Gurgaon, a new generation is redefining the traditional lifestyle. The rise of the tech industry and global connectivity has introduced a faster pace of life, characterized by cafe culture, fitness trends, and a shift toward individualistic career goals. Yet, even within this modernity, Indian roots remain visible. A software engineer might start their day with yoga—a practice thousands of years old—before commuting to a high-tech office. This blending of the old and new is the hallmark of contemporary Indian identity.
